QUESTIONS FOR A/E PRESENTERS
1. What do you see as the major challenges to overcome to build this project?
2. What is the weakness in the design team that concerns you most, and how do you plan to
minimize its impact on this project?
3. Please explain your quality assurance process to ensure accuracy in drawings, specs, and
calculations across disciplines.
4. Please speak to the proposed cost estimating process and cost control measures i.e.
• How often and at what stages should KIB expect a formal cost estimate?
• Describe the estimator's usual frequency of performing local cost analysis.
5. What is your firm's experience with site selection and feasibility studies with this type of
project?
6. What is your proposed strategy to control costs and deliver a quality sustainable facility?
7. Explain the design team's experience and competencies working in BIM. What level of BIM do
you propose to use on this project.
8. KIB is considering that "chasing LEED" may not be in its best interest given its location and other
conditions unique to Kodiak Island. Please speak to the pros and cons of seeking LEED
certification for this project.
9. What preliminary architectural or structural design features have you already discussed that
would make this facility distinctly Kodiak?
10. Discuss the successful and not so successful features and strategies specific to the function of
the project utilized for your past projects.
11. Discuss materials and features which would help keep construction costs lower.
12. Explain the code aspect of the project; residential /commercial? Can a plastic pipe sprinkler
system be used? Cook range and venting?
13. In past similar projects were there any third party requirements which needed to be addressed
and complicated building construction or materials selection?
14. There have been many resident home models built in the United States and many lessons have
been learned during the construction and occupancy /use of these homes, improving design in
each new "generation" of home. What resident's long term care home model design resources
are you aware of and will possibly access in order to help design our homes for the optimal
living comfort and functionality for staff /operations?
